We spent our Sunday in this town, about two hours away from here.
People often scoff at it as too touristy (complete with an eye roll
and a flip of the hand), but there often is a reason that places like
this are frequented by tourists: they are interesting. This is the
perfect little German town with a village square, shops and cafes,
churches, and a whole mess of half-timbered houses, all within a
wall. It was very Disneyland-like, only for real.
